Best 90303 California Public Schools (2025)

For the 2025 school year, there are 5 public schools serving 2,198 students in 90303, CA.
The top ranked public schools in 90303, CA are Environmental Charter Middle - Inglewood, Century Park Elementary School and Bennett/kew P-8 Leadership Academy Of Excellence. Overall testing rank is based on a school's combined math and reading proficiency test score ranking.
Public schools in zipcode 90303 have an average math proficiency score of 24% (versus the California public school average of 34%), and reading proficiency score of 30% (versus the 47% statewide average). Schools in 90303, CA have an average ranking of 3/10, which is in the bottom 50% of California public schools.
Minority enrollment is 100%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is more than the California public school average of 80% (majority Hispanic).
